How to Get a Trike License

If you're considering purchasing a Can-Am Spyder or Polaris Slingshot or any other kind of motorcycle with three wheels you must obtain the proper license. The requirements for trike licenses in each state differ. Certain states require a specific endorsement on your driver's licence, while others require you to simply take a test for your skills.
To get a 3-wheel motorcycle endorsement on your driver's license you will need to attend the Basic Rider Course (BRC). The course consists of five hours of classroom instruction and 10 hours of riding. You will receive a BRC completion certificate after you have completed. You will also need to bring an unicycle or side-hack (registered, insured) as well as a helmet and eye protection.

Most states require trike motorcycle drivers to take a 3-Wheel Basic Rider Course (3WBRC). The course includes classroom instruction and riding exercises designed specifically for vehicles with 3 wheels. Students receive a certificate after completion of the class that they can bring to their local DMV for a certificate to add the endorsement to their existing motorcycle.
In some states, drivers are able to obtain an endorsement for a motorcycle with three wheels or license after passing a standard driver's test. The licenses are still restricted to only driving 3-wheeled motorbikes.
In some states, a driver must take a separate test to obtain a 3-wheel endorsement. This license is only valid for a 3-wheel motorbike and cannot be used on other types of vehicles.
